Shriprakash R Pandey is the present Chairman and Managing Director[1] of Commtel Networks, a provider of communication, surveillance, and related technology solutions for Oil & Gas, Power, Transportation, and Defense sectors.[2]

Early life

Born and brought up in Mumbai,[3] Shriprakash completed his Advanced Management Program from Indian School of Business, Hyderabad and Kellogg School of Management at Chicago, IL. He commenced his career as an Engineer in the year 1991 at Olex Cables, an Australian multinational firm. Later within 7 years, he went on to head Olex's Indian Operations.[4]

Career

He established Commtel Networks in July 1998.[5] Today he also serves on the board of United Commtel,[6] a Texas-based NexGen communication innovation company. Commtel Networks hosts a range of products as well as services in the areas[7] of Systems Design Engineering, Integration, Implementation, Project Management, and Multi-location Supply Chain Management, as well as a 24x7 support.[8]

Commtel Networks

Commtel Networks Private Limited, headquartered in Mumbai, is a provider of telecommunication, surveillance, and related technology solutions.[9] It designs, builds, and manages networks over fiber, radio, or copper media—primarily in the sectors of Oil & Gas, Power, Transportation, and Defense.[10]
